    the internal valve protects the liquid from spilling in a accident i think that's a mc 416 Durracane or rubber lined. 407 is for flammable in case of fire the heat will melt the solder close the valve flammables are pressured with nitrogen. tanks for 5 years.

    For all of you saying it's impossible to make 2500 a week in trucking. It's not impossible but you have to keep your license clean and have some years under your belt. And it's usually not in general FRIEGHT (Dry box, refer, ect) unless you own your equipment and don't lease and you find your own loads. Start with a broker then just talk about a contract with everyone you pickup and deliver too yes it morally objectionable but it's your life and your business make the best of it. Tanks in general always pay better unless your with a major company. Note find the company that doesn't have the newest equipment and keeps their overhead low they generally pay the best if your a company type and in company not for hires usually pay better. You have to look but they are out there.

    There is an upside and downside to every aspect of trucking. I've done just about every aspect of it. Dry Van, Reefer, Tank, Intermodal, Flatbed, heavy haul, dump. I never hauled cars or medium duty trucks...I looked into it...I said "NO THANKS!!!", way to much finesse to loading and unloading, climbing in and out.
    Tank work is good for exactly what this guy described, you go out and back, out and back...very little hunting for a load to bring you back. There are some downside to tanking...driving with surge sucks. Definitely not for rookie-level. Sudden move or hard brake, you better leave some room, that load is going to push you around. Even just running down the road, open bore tank, the load will remind you it's still there...always sloshing! :-0
    Sometimes the hours of operation are bizarre, run all hours day and night. You do have to have extra equipment you don't find standard on most trucks for off-loading, PTO, air pumps.
    It has some dangers, chemicals, odors, wait time to start loading/unloading can be LONG...you can't control...you get to the shipper, the product isn't ready to load. You get to the destination, there is a line of trucks in front or, there is not enough room for you to unload. You'll get detention, after 2 hours, but, it is generally far less $ per hour than what you make running down the road, and, puts you behind on your schedule, you end up driving tired!
    This guy is EXACTLY right on the smaller companies. There are some real good ones out there. The big ones, your just a number, they don't respect or give a damn about you, the individual. I ran for Carry Transit and 3 or 4 other smaller, private companies...small guys rocked.
    Flatbed is pretty good, but throwing tarps SUCKS!!! Dry freight and reefer ALWAYS around, but, a lot of time in the dock and, God-help you if you are doing loads for big retail like Walmart...they are the WORST for getting in and out.
    Dump work was good, home nightly but, seasonal work and headache deal with Teamsters.
    The one thing I can say is TERRIBLE is Intermodal. The WORST trucking, rattiest trucks, tons of time lost in rail yards. ELD will kill the intermodal bizz. At least what I have seen doing it in Chicago, can't make money doing intermodal there. Can't make money running cross-town freight in a big city like Chicago. Maybe if you are taking further away, longer runs. I never got into doing that.
    Find what you like, do it well!
